Are Telehealth Sessions Covered under Standard Aba Billing Codes?
Yes, telehealth sessions are covered under the standard ABA billing codes, but they require specific modifications to be processed correctly.
According to the provided content, billing for telehealth involves the following requirements:
- Consistent CPT Codes: Telehealth services use the same standard Category I CPT codes as in-person sessions (such as 97151, 97153, or 97155).
- Required Modifiers: To indicate that the service was performed virtually, you must append specific modifiers to the CPT code. Use modifier 95 for synchronous video sessions or modifier GT for interactive audio/video sessions.
- Billing Units: Sessions are still billed in the standard 15-minute increments, following the same rules as in-person therapy.
- Insurance Variation: While the core coding remains the same, coverage for virtual visits varies by insurance plan. Some payers may require prior authorization for telehealth, and state autism insurance mandates can also influence specific payer policies.
It is recommended to verify benefits for your specific plan, as insurance coverage is subject to verification and is not guaranteed.
